The role:

Harlow District Council are seeking an experienced Quantity Surveyor who is available on short notice to join the Housing Operations team to support on a large construction programme.

Pre-contract

  • Work with the pre-construction, procurement and design teams to prepare early cost estimates of the proposed works and total project costs. Such works will include major refurbishment of building assets (envelope and internals) and routine maintenance and building compliance.
  • Monitor the design development and update estimates of work / prepare cost plans at key stages of the design.
  • Work closely with pre-contract team, identify and quantify risk.
  • Assist with procurement strategy and the preparation of contract documents for tender.
  • Assist with tender documentation and management of the tender process.
  • Attend internal and external stakeholder meetings (noting these may very occasionally be after hours).

Construction stage

  • Input into pre-start meetings and carry out due diligence and compliance checks before commencement of the works.
  • Review project issues, risks and opportunities monthly.
  • Provide accurate monthly financial reports to senior team.
  • A key requirement is an ability to manage and present high volumes of cost data.
  • Presenting financial reports / updates to stakeholders.
  • Chair internal and external meetings and producing minutes.
  • Attend internal and external stakeholder meetings (noting these may very occasionally be after hours).

Project Close

  • Award PC when achieved.
  • Settle the final accounts.
  • Manage any defects and the defects period.
  • Ensure copies of all close out / completion documents, such a test certificates, O&M manuals, “Golden Thread” information and product warranties etc. are obtained.

Qualifications/Experience & Key Requirements

  • Suitably qualified in field.
  • Chartered (RICS) is preferred.
  • Demonstratable experience as quantity surveyor / contract administrator / employers agent.
  • Strong knowledge in preparing and managing JCT Contracts.
